1. Stack Overflow

  • What Is It? – Stack Overflow is a Q&A platform primarily focused on programming and software development. It’s a go-to resource for developers seeking solutions to coding challenges.
  • Why It’s Great – With millions of members, you can get quick answers to your coding questions. Plus, the community actively upvotes the best solutions for easy reference.

2. Tom’s Hardware

  • What Is It? – Tom’s Hardware is a popular forum dedicated to all things tech hardware-related. Whether you’re building a PC or troubleshooting a malfunctioning component, this community has your back.
  • Why It’s Great – The forum is well-organized, making it easy to navigate. You can find detailed discussions and reviews about the latest hardware trends.

3. Reddit’s r/TechSupport

  • What Is It? – Reddit’s r/TechSupport is a subreddit where tech enthusiasts and experts come together to assist with a wide range of tech problems.
  • Why It’s Great – The diverse user base means you can find help for nearly any tech issue. It’s also a welcoming community, making it beginner-friendly.

4. CNET Forums

  • What Is It? – CNET Forums are part of the CNET tech news website and provide a platform for discussions on various tech topics.
  • Why It’s Great – CNET’s forums cover a wide spectrum of tech subjects, from troubleshooting to product reviews. It’s a reliable source of tech advice.

5. XDA Developers

  • What Is It? – XDA Developers is a community for Android enthusiasts. It’s the go-to place for custom ROMs, app development, and Android device troubleshooting.
  • Why It’s Great – If you’re into Android, this forum is a treasure trove of information. You’ll find solutions to common Android issues and discover ways to unlock your device’s potential.

6. Microsoft Community

  • What Is It? – The Microsoft Community is the official forum for Microsoft products and services. It’s the place to seek help with Windows, Office, and more.
  • Why It’s Great – Microsoft’s experts and MVPs actively participate in the community, providing reliable solutions and guidance for Windows-related issues.

7. Apple Support Communities

  • What Is It? – Apple Support Communities are the go-to for all things Apple. Whether you have questions about your iPhone, Mac, or other Apple devices, this is the place to be.
  • Why It’s Great – Apple’s official support community ensures you’re getting accurate advice and solutions directly from Apple users and experts.

8. BleepingComputer

  • What Is It? – BleepingComputer specializes in malware removal and PC security. It’s your lifeline when dealing with computer viruses and security threats.
  • Why It’s Great – The community’s focus on security means you’ll find step-by-step guides and expert advice on protecting your computer.

9. TechSpot Forums

  • What Is It? – TechSpot Forums cover a wide range of tech topics, including hardware, software, gaming, and more.
  • Why It’s Great – It’s a friendly community with knowledgeable members, making it easy to find help with your tech issues.

10. AnandTech Forums

- **What Is It?** - AnandTech Forums are known for their in-depth discussions on hardware and technology.
- **Why It's Great** - If you're a tech enthusiast looking for detailed insights into hardware components and gadgets, this forum is a valuable resource.

11. Spiceworks Community

  • What Is It? – Spiceworks Community is a platform for IT professionals and tech enthusiasts to discuss and troubleshoot tech-related issues in a business environment.
  • Why It’s Great – It’s an excellent resource for professionals managing IT in organizations, providing solutions to complex tech challenges specific to the workplace.

12. Digital Photography Review Forums

  • What Is It? – These forums cater to photography enthusiasts seeking advice on camera gear, photography techniques, and post-processing tips.
  • Why It’s Great – If you’re passionate about photography and want to enhance your skills, this community offers insights and recommendations to help you capture stunning shots.

13. LinuxQuestions.org

  • What Is It? – LinuxQuestions.org is a community dedicated to Linux users, offering assistance with Linux operating systems and open-source software.
  • Why It’s Great – For those diving into the world of Linux, this forum provides guidance, troubleshooting tips, and discussions about various distributions and software.
